Cwmtirmynach Chapel (welsh Calvinistic Methodist), Glan-yr-afon, Cwm Tirmynach

8493 ·

Cwmtirmynach Methodist Chapel was built in 1826 and rebuilt in 1880 in the Lombardic/Italian style of the gable-entry type.

Rhosygwalia Chapel (welsh Calvinistic Methodist;rhosygwaliau), Rhosygwaliau

8498 ·

Rhosygwalia Methodist Chapel was built in 1881 in the Vernacular style of the gable-entry type.

Carmel Welsh Independent Chapel, Penantlliw, Dolhendre

8527 ·

Carmel Independent Chapel was built in 1833 and rebuilt in 1893 in the Vernacular style of the gable-entry type.

Jerwsalem Welsh Independent Church (jerusalem), A487, Trawsfynydd

8596 ·

Jerwsalem Independent Chapel was built in 1826 and rebuilt in 1893 in the Vernacular style of the gable-entry type.
